Introduction

The Emerson SE4001S5T2B5 Event Sequence Input Card is a specialized I/O module designed for high-resolution event detection within DeltaV distributed control systems. It records precise time-stamped changes in discrete input signals, enabling accurate sequence-of-events analysis for industrial automation applications. Built for mission-critical environments, it enhances system diagnostics, traceability, and operational reliability in complex process control systems.

Technical FAQs

Q1: What is the main function of the SE4001S5T2B5 module?
A: It captures and records high-speed discrete input events with precise time sequencing.

Q2: What type of system is this card used in?
A: It is used in Emerson DeltaV distributed control systems.

Q3: What does “Sequence of Events” mean in this module?
A: It refers to time-stamped recording of changes in digital input states for analysis.

Q4: Is this module suitable for safety-critical applications?
A: Yes, it is widely used in systems requiring accurate event tracking and diagnostics.

Q5: What type of signals does it process?
A: It processes discrete on/off digital input signals.
